What it's like to attend

Children arrive at the pre-school with enthusiasm and are greeted warmly by staff, fostering a strong sense of belonging and emotional security. The pre-school offers a broad curriculum, and children actively engage with prepared activities and other available resources, using their imaginations and developing independence. Leaders and staff maintain high expectations for behaviour, serving as excellent role models, which results in children behaving very well.

Inspector highlights

  • Children come into the pre-school full of enthusiasm.
  • The pre-school offers a broad curriculum, and children excitedly engage with the prepared activities or choose from other available resources.
  • Children show independence skills as they get themselves ready to play outside.
  • Leaders and staff have high expectations of children's behaviour.
  • Staff support children's language and communication skills extremely well.

Areas to develop

  • 1encourage staff to be more flexible in the intent of some adult-planned activities so that they do not miss any spontaneous opportunities for children to explore the activity in different ways.

Inclusion & environment

How they support every child

SEND provision

Staff are skilful in adapting questions or instructions, putting them in simpler terms and providing visual prompts. This is particularly helpful to those children with special educational needs and/or disabilities (SEND). Leaders check that assessment processes quickly identify any gaps in children's learning so that all children, including those with SEND, make good progress.

Outdoor space

Children show independence skills as they get themselves ready to play outside. They run about happily in the large open space and look for coloured balls hidden in the bushes and between the flowers. They benefit from having access to a wildlife area where they can watch the birds and learn more about the natural world.

About the setting

Rainbow Pre School Playgroup registered in 2004 and operates from Bridgwater, Somerset. It opens from Monday to Friday, 8.30am until 3.15pm, during term time only. The pre-school employs five members of staff; three hold childcare qualifications at level 3 and two hold a level 2 qualification.
